NSAIDS and Chronic Kidney Disease

www.cdc.gov

NSAIDs have been associated with acute kidney injury in the general population and with progression of disease in those with chronic kidney disease. NSAIDs may also decrease the effectiveness of certain prescription medications that are often used by people with kidney disease, such as angiotensin-converting enzyme (ACE) inhibitors, angiotensin ...

Understanding the Difference Among MAM, SAM, and GAM …

www.globalhealthlearning.org

Severe Acute Malnutrition (SAM) is identified by severe wasting WFH < ‐3 z‐score for children 0‐59 months (or for children 6‐59 months, MUAC <115 mm) or the presence of bilateral pitting edema. Global Acute Malnutrition (GAM) is the presence of both MAM and SAM in a population.
